On Mon, Jul 07, 2003 at 03:49:38PM +0100, Simon Peyton-Jones wrote:
> Some of you have already discovered that GHC 6.0 has a nasty bug: if you
> go
> 	ghci foo\Baz.hs
> and there is any error at all in Baz.hs, then GHC deletes the source
> file!   This seems like excessive punishment for a type error.

And it doesn't even require a type error as an excuse for punishment!

.. if the source file is specified as ./file.hs

Example:

  $ echo "module T where" > T.hs && ghc --make ./T.hs -v
  ...
  Deleting: ./T.hs
 

This is on linux, don't know about windows..
